to luxuriate in sth

listen to the pronunciation of to luxuriate in sth
Английский Язык - Немецкий Язык

Определение to luxuriate in sth в Английский Язык Немецкий Язык словарь

to luxuriate in something
sich in etwas aalen
to luxuriate in something
in etwas baden
to luxuriate in sth.
sich in etw. aalen